can I get admission in m.sc through SAT exam?

Anurag Khanna 19th Aug, 2020

Hello Aspirant,

Unfortunately no, you cannot take admission in M.Sc course through Scholastic Assessment Test (SAT) because it is a postgraduate course and SAT is for admission to undergraduate courses in different countries across the world.
